WebDec 15, 2013 · When you bind a empty list to a DGV default row will be removed. If you need to display an empty row then do like this, //Adding a client object to the collection so that an empty row will be inserted to DGV clientDataSource.Add (new Client ()); clientDataGridView.DataSource = clientDataSource; Share.
